Overview

Dr. Daniel Oren is an Incoming Attending Hospitalist Physician in the Department of Medicine, Division of Cardiology at Columbia University Irving Medical Center. He is also an Associated Research Scientist at the Center for Advanced Cardiac Care - Heart Failure Research Institute at CUIMC. He received his MD from Semmelweis University Medical School and holds a MSc. in Medical Science also from Semmelweis University Medical School, and is a candidate for MSc. in Theoretical and Mathematical Biology & Biostatistics from Tel Aviv University Faculty of Life Sciences. He is currently board eligible for New York Medical License and is a Certified Israeli Medical Board. Dr. Oren was also recognized with the “Teaching Resident of the Year” award in both 2023 and 2024.
